Hello Gasherbaum-

I enjoy the Thiel CS 2.4SE the best. if I had the correct space, I would buy the CS 3.7. Krell is a very good match, as well as, Pass Labs for SS duty.

On the Tubey side, ARC, Conrad Johnson & Aesthetix would be a sonic match. Cabling matches are: Audioquest, Audience,
Nordost, Silent Source, Transparent and Wireworld- so you have many choices depending on the gear.
